Campaign For Better Health Care - History

History

A year before CBHC’s founding, a handful of downstate community organizations (Danville Area Community Services Council and the Champaign County Health Care Consumers) and statewide grassroots health care organizations (Illinois State Council of Senior Citizens now called Illinois Alliance for Retired Americans, Illinois Public Action Council now called Illinois Citizen Action, and the Coalition for Consumer Rights) establish the Campaign for Better Health Care to develop into the central statewide grassroots health care organization responsible for the health reform battle.
